adjective
That has been organized or arranged in an appropriate manner.
The party was very well arranged with decorations and music.
La fiesta estuvo muy arreglada con decoraciones y música.
That is in an adequate or correct state.
Her room is always arranged and clean.
Su habitación siempre está arreglada y limpia.
A person who dresses well or formally.
She always presents herself arranged for meetings.
Ella siempre se presenta arreglada para las reuniones.
Etymology
From the verb 'to arrange', which originates from the Latin 'adregulare'.
